Dortmund vs Mainz predictions

Dortmund are midtable with 35 points from 26 matches. 

The gap to the top four is now in double figures, and BVB has just eight matches to close it. The reality is that it is already too late. 

Last season’s beaten Champions League finalists have won just ten matches in the Bundesliga. There have also been five draws, and highlighting just how inconsistent they have been, BVB has lost 11 times. 

A change of manager seems to have made little difference. Niko Kovac took control of the team at the beginning of February. 

There was a brief improvement in results, with wins in the Champions League and over Union Berlin and St. Pauli in the Bundesliga, but the cold hard facts are that the Black and Yellows have won two and lost four of Kovac’s six league matches in charge.

Dortmund’s most recent result was a 2-0 defeat away to Leipzig on Matchday 26. Goals from Xavi Simons and Lois Openda ensured BVB went into the international break on the back of another defeat.

High-flying Mainz are unbeaten in their last six with four wins and two draws. This excellent run of form has seen them gatecrash the top four, and they are right in the heart of the battle for a Champions League place next season. 

When Mainz beat Bayern Munich 2-1 on Matchday 14, it looked like one of those freak results. They sat ninth in the league at the time and literally no one saw the shock win coming.

Little did we know it was the start of something special for Bo Henriksen’s team. Three wins and three defeats followed the win over Bayern.

But since Die Nullfunfer last tasted defeat against Werder on Matchday 20, they have picked up 14 points from an unbeaten run of six matches. 

The unbeaten run started with a 0-0 draw at home to Augsburg. A four match winning streak followed. 

That winning run unfortunately came to an end when Henriksen’s team were held to a 2-2 draw by Freiburg on Matchday 26.
